Vmware安装Ubuntu16.4、Ubuntu里安装python3.9、Ubuntu安装PyCharm的过程及出现的问题的解决

目录

1、VMware安装Ubuntu16.4虚拟机

1.1、下载Ubuntu镜像文件

1.2、安装Ubuntu虚拟机

1.2、装Ubuntu系统 和 虚拟机工具

1.3、解决Ubuntu不能全屏显示

1.4、设置共享文件夹

1.4.1、主机上的文件夹设置

1.4.2、虚拟机上的设置

1.5、解决/mnt下没有hgfs文件夹

1.6、解决找不到共享文件夹的问题

1.7、 解决重启后共享文件夹没有了的问题

 2、Ubuntu安装Python3.9

2.1、安装Python3.9

2.2、设置软链接

2.3、解决 执行ipython时 ModuleNotFoundError: No module named ‘CommandNotFound’ 报错 

2.4、解决 执行ipython时 ModuleNotFoundError: No module named ‘IPython’ 报错 

3、Ubuntu安装PyCharm

说明:


1、VMware安装Ubuntu16.4虚拟机

1.1、下载Ubuntu镜像文件

Ubuntu16.4镜像文件下载地址:阿里云开源镜像站资源目录 (aliyun.com)

 根据自己电脑位数下载桌面版的iso文件:


1.2、安装Ubuntu虚拟机

图片太多,凑一起看:

 安装好后就要设置驱动,就是用到刚刚下载的Ubuntu镜像文件:


1.2、装Ubuntu系统 和 虚拟机工具

然后进入虚拟机,开始自动装系统:

安装好后系统会要求重启,让系统自动重启可能会一直卡那,所以可以手动重启

 进入虚拟机后,我们就直接先安装好VmwareTools,如图点击安装VMwareTools

然后到虚拟机内,就会有如下窗口:

然后把上图这个VMwareTools这个压缩包复制到另一个文件夹(自己祟拜你创建的)里面,再右键单击空白处选择终端中打开

 进行解压缩:

tar -zxvf VMwareTools-10.3.21-14772444.tar.gz

 然后进入到安装程序目录:

cd vmware-tools-distrib/

 然后在终端中执行安装:

./vmware-install.pl

 然后就是一直回车,直到安装完成。


1.3、解决Ubuntu不能全屏显示

如果你的Ubuntu在VM里面不能全屏显示的话,先在终端中输入命令

sudo apt-get install open-vm-tools

这步执行完后基本就能全屏显示了,如果没有再在终端输入:

sudo apt-get install open-vm*

1.4、设置共享文件夹

1.4.1、主机上的文件夹设置

在你要共享的文件上右键单击,选择 属性 ,选择 共享:

点击共享后,选择共享的用户,下拉选择Everyone,添加,共享


1.4.2、虚拟机上的设置

看图操作即可,最后设置完成要记得点击确定:

 然后就可以在Ubuntu的/mnt/hgfs路径下查看共享的文件夹


1.5、解决/mnt下没有hgfs文件夹

这种情况需要重新安装VMwareTools,如果虚拟机上的重装VMwareTools的选项为灰色不可选,可以先把虚拟机关机(是关机),在重新开启虚拟机的时候就会看到重装VMwareTools的选项可选了,点击他,然后就会回到上面安装VMwareTools的步骤。


1.6、解决找不到共享文件夹的问题

经历了以上步骤,如果找不到共享文件夹的话,

先打开终端,输入命令:

vmhgfs-fuse .host:/  /mnt/hgfs/

然后查看是否能看到共享文件夹,如果还是不能,那再输入以下命令查看共享文件夹是否设置成功:

vmware-hgfsclient

 如上图出现了共享文件夹的名称说明设置成功,然后在输入以下命令:

sudo vmhgfs-fuse .host:/ /mnt -o nonempty -o allow_other

就可以在/mnt/hgfs中看到共享文件夹了。


1.7、 解决重启后共享文件夹没有了的问题

将上一步的操作设置为每次重启自动执行就可以解决这个问题:

先给一个叫rc.local的文件设置权限,让他可读可写可执行:

sudo chmod 777 /etc/rc.local

然后将他打开并编辑,在   exit 0  的前面的位置插入以下命令:

sudo vmhgfs-fuse .host/ /mnt/hgfs -o nonempty -o allow_other

 然后每次重启就不会找不到共享文件夹了。 


 2、Ubuntu安装Python3.9

2.1、安装Python3.9

打开终端,先安装编译依赖项:

sudo apt install -y wget build-essential libreadline-dev libncursesw5-dev libssl-dev libsqlite3-dev tk-dev libgdbm-dev libc6-dev libbz2-dev libffi-dev zlib1g-dev

再下载源码包:

wget https://www.python.org/ftp/python/3.9.0/Python-3.9.0b4.tgz

解压源码包:

tar -zxvf Python-3.9.0b4.tgz  

然后进入到刚刚解压的目录中:

cd Python-3.9.0b4

设置编译参数:

./configure --prefix=/usr/local/python3

 编译:

make

安装:

sudo make install

出现如下提示为安装成功:


2.2、设置软链接

先删除原先系统的链接:

sudo rm python
sudo rm python3
 #并不会删除 python2.7 和 python3.5

 如果在删除的过程中出现了”没有那个文件或目录“的报错,那么用要删除对象的绝对地址来进行删除:

 删除后,设置软链接:

sudo ln -s /usr/local/python3/bin/python3.9 /usr/bin/python3
sudo ln -s /usr/local/python3/bin/python3.9 /usr/bin/python

再设置pip的软链接

sudo ln -s /usr/local/python3/bin/pip3.9 /usr/bin/pip3
sudo ln -s /usr/local/python3/bin/pip3.9 /usr/bin/pip

然后就安装完成了:


2.3、解决 执行ipython时 ModuleNotFoundError: No module named ‘CommandNotFound’ 报错 

 报错如图:根据报错的信息,找到相关文件:

给他设置权限,让我们可以编辑:

sudo chmod 777 /usr/lib/command-not-found

然后在该文件的第一行把3修改为自己系统python的版本(我这是3.5),然后保存退出

 此时执行ipython会有提示安装:

然后输入这两个命令,就可以安装上ipython。


2.4、解决 执行ipython时 ModuleNotFoundError: No module named ‘IPython’ 报错 

报错如图:

意思是没有IPython这个模块,所以我们直接下载好这个模块就可以了:

pip install IPython

但是我在下载的时候又碰上这样的报错:

 查了好久也没搞好,最后还是靠自己探索出来才成功,方法如下:

在home里面有一个get-pip.py文件:

 先给设置权限,让他可以执行:

sudo chmod +x get-pip.py

 然后执行:

./get-pip.py

然后会有提示,进行pip的更新,于是就直接更新:

/usr/bin/python -m pip install --upgrad pip

最后在执行安装IPython的命令就可以了,安装好后就能执行ipython了:

pip install IPython


3、Ubuntu安装PyCharm

先进到官网下载Linux版的安装包:Download PyCharm: Python IDE for Professional Developers by JetBrains

 如图,我选择社区版下载:

 下载好后,我的Ubuntu自动跳出窗口,点击提取:

 然后选择提取位置,之后就会有提取成功提示:

 然后到被提取出来的文件夹的bin目录下,在这打开终端:

注意这有个pycharm.sh文件,我们执行他,就会出现下图页面,选择continue:

./pycharm.sh

 然后会有以下页面,我选择Don't:

 然后就打开了PyCharm,点击左下角的设置图标:

如图点击创建一个桌面进入方式:

勾选上这个复选框,点击ok:

然后就可以使用了。


说明:

以上全是我自己这两天多次安装Ubuntu虚拟机、python3.9所经过的步骤和遇到的问题,在网上查了很多文章,尽管有些命令不全明白意义,但是效果都是亲测有效。

  • 12
    点赞
  • 40
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 7
    评论
### 回答1: Python3.9的安装教程: 1. 首先,打开浏览器,进入官方Python网站(python.org)。 2. 在页面的顶部导航菜单中选择“Downloads”。 3. 在下载页面中,向下滚动并找到“Python 3.9.0”版(或更高版本)。 4. 根据您的操作系统,选择正确的安装程序(例如Windows的exe安装程序)。 5. 下载完毕后,运行安装程序。 6. 在安装向导中,选择安装Python的位置和选项,并点击“Next”继续。 7. 完成安装后,可以在命令行中输入“python”命令来验证是否安装成功。 PyCharm安装教程: 1. 同样,打开浏览器,进入JetBrains官方网站(jetbrains.com)。 2. 导航到PyCharm页面,选择适用于您的操作系统的版本。 3. 点击下载,等待下载完成。 4. 运行安装程序,按照安装向导进行操作。 5. 在安装过程中,可以选择安装其他组件和设置选项。 6. 安装完成后,启动PyCharmPython简单代码示例: ```python # 打印Hello World print("Hello World") # 计算两个数的和 num1 = 5 num2 = 3 sum = num1 + num2 print("两数之和为:", sum) # 判断一个数是否为偶数 num = 6 if num % 2 == 0: print(num, "是偶数") else: print(num, "是奇数") # 循环输出数字 for i in range(1, 6): print(i, end=" ") print() # 列表操作 fruits = ["apple", "banana", "orange"] fruits.append("grape") print("水果列表:", fruits) print("第二个水果:", fruits[1]) # 字典操作 person = {"name": "John", "age": 25, "city": "New York"} print("姓名:", person["name"]) print("年龄:", person["age"]) print("所在城市:", person["city"]) ``` 这些是Python3.9的安装教程和一些简单的Python代码示例。希望对你有帮助! ### 回答2: Python3.9安装教程: 1. 首先,访问Python官方网站(www.python.org)并下载最新版本的Python3.9安装程序。 2. 打开下载好的安装程序,运行安装程序。 3. 在安装向导中,选择自定义安装,然后点击下一步。 4. 选择要安装的组件,建议勾选“将Python添加到环境变量”选项,以便在命令行中可以直接使用Python命令。 5. 设置安装路径,可以保留默认设置,也可以自定义安装路径。 6. 点击下一步,然后点击安装开始安装Python。 7. 安装完成后,可以选择安装附加的第三方模块,也可以跳过这一步。 PyCharm安装教程: 1. 访问JetBrains官方网站(https://www.jetbrains.com/pycharm/)并下载适合您操作系统的PyCharm安装程序。 2. 运行下载好的安装程序,启动安装过程。 3. 在安装向导中,可以选择自定义安装选项,也可以保留默认设置。 4. 设置安装路径,可以保留默认设置,也可以自定义安装路径。 5. 选择启动菜单文件夹和桌面快捷方式等选项。 6. 点击安装,等待安装程序完成安装。 7. 安装完成后,启动PyCharm,按照提示进行初始化设置。 Python简单代码示例: 下面是一个简单的Python代码示例,它可以计算并输出两个数字的和: ```python num1 = int(input("请输入第一个数字:")) num2 = int(input("请输入第二个数字:")) sum = num1 + num2 print("两个数字的和是:", sum) ``` 在上述代码中,我们首先使用input函数从用户处获取两个数字,并使用int函数将输入的字符串转换为整数。 然后,我们将两个数字相加,并将结果存储在sum变量中。 最后,我们使用print函数将结果输出到控制台。 ### 回答3: Python 3.9的安装教程: 1. 首先,打开浏览器,访问Python官方网站(https://www.python.org/downloads/)。 2. 在网页中找到并点击下载Python 3.9版本的安装程序。 3. 根据你的操作系统,选择合适的安装程序进行下载。 4. 下载完成后,双击运行安装程序。 5. 在安装向导中,选择要安装Python版本以及安装路径等选项。 6. 点击“下一步”继续安装,直到安装完成。 PyCharm安装教程: 1. 打开浏览器,访问JetBrains官方网站(https://www.jetbrains.com/pycharm/download/)。 2. 在网页中找到并点击下载适用于你的操作系统的PyCharm Community或Professional版本。 3. 下载完成后,双击运行安装程序。 4. 在安装向导中,选择安装目录和其他选项。 5. 点击“下一步”继续安装,直到安装完成。 Python简单代码示例: 以下是一个简单的Python代码示例,计算两个数的和并将结果打印出来。 ```python a = 10 b = 5 sum = a + b print("两数之和为:", sum) ``` 运行上述代码,将会输出: ``` 两数之和为: 15 ``` 这是一个非常简单的示例,你可以根据自己的需求编写更复杂的Python代码。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 7
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

多低调

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值